Title: The Power of Words to Hurt and Heal           

Text:

Proverbs 10:18-21 (HCSB)
18
The one who conceals hatred has lying lips, and whoever spreads slander is a fool.
19
When there are many words, sin is unavoidable, but the one who controls his lips is wise.
20
The tongue of the righteous is pure silver; the heart of the wicked is of little value.
21 The lips of the righteous feed many, but fools die for lack of sense.

Observation:

At its best life can be difficult. Inappropriate words spoken at the wrong time can be devastating. Our words have the power to build or destroy. Notice what the Word says about this unruly member.

James 3:6-8 (NLT)
6
And the tongue is a flame of fire. It is a whole world of wickedness, corrupting your entire body. It can set your whole life on fire, for it is set on fire by hell itself.
7
People can tame all kinds of animals, birds, reptiles, and fish,
8 but no one can tame the tongue. It is restless and evil, full of deadly poison.

The problem is with the heart. Is your heart right before God? When you open your mouth are you speaking from the wisdom of God or the wisdom of the world? Get God’s Word in you and the best will come out of you.

Hebrews 4:12 (NLT)
12 For the word of God is alive and powerful. It is sharper than the sharpest two-edged sword, cutting between soul and spirit, between joint and marrow. It exposes our innermost thoughts and desires.
